Application

Suitable for derivatization of Υ-aminobutyric acid, n-acetylneuraminic acid, dipeptides, dopamine O-sulfate (3- and 4-isomers), fatty acids, amino sugar methyl glycosides, glycosphingolipi, n-hydroxylamines, a-ketoacids, mesoxalic acid, nitrilotriacetate, phenolic acids, phospholipids, phosphoserine and phosphothreonine, prostaglandins F, prostaglandin H2 methyl ester, psiocin, psiocybin, terbutaline and thiohydantoins of amino acids, and thromboxane B2.

Other Notes

Reagent for N-acetyl, O-trimethylesilyl, sulfonyl trimethylsilyl esters, trimethylsilyl (TMS), trimethylsilyl diglyceride, trimethylsilyl quinoxalone and trimethylsilyl thiohydantoins.

D B Repke et al.
Journal of pharmaceutical sciences, 66(5), 743-744 (1977-05-01)
With the combined technique of GLC-mass spectrometry, psilocin and psilocybin, two hallucinogenic indoles, were analyzed as their trimethylsilyl derivatives. The method was applied to these two components in an extract of Psilocybe cubensis (Earle) Sing.
